Semaphore survivor

There are still pockets of semaphore signalling that survive in south Wales including here at Park Junction, Newport. The large signalbox, just visible behind the vegetation on the left, dates back to 1885 and has a 100 lever frame and survives despite being originally scheduled for closure in 2017.

 

Class 150 Sprinter unit no.150227 prepares to take the Ebbw Vale line with 2N09 09:34 Cardiff Central to Ebbw Vale Town service on the 23rd May 2018.
